To: Executive Team
Subject: Vextrel launch — final plan

Team, launch for Vextrel is locked: soft release in the Doveny region first, full rollout four weeks later. Pricing holds at the agreed tier. Marketing assets clear review Thursday. Incoming director Halsa will own post-launch metrics from day one. One item stays off the public roadmap, and it is set out just below.

confidential, kagup-bafog: Fraaxax Group is in early talks to buy Soroxox Group for about $343.8 million. The Olidor launch date is June 14, and nothing goes to the press before then. Legal wants the Aldmirek Logistics term sheet signed before July 23.

Runbook: Givebright receipt mailer. If receipts queue but don't send, restart the mailer pod and check the bounce log. Rebuild the env file if it's missing: set MAIL_REGION to north, BATCH_SIZE to 100, and TEMPLATE_VER to 7. The SMTP credential goes on the line immediately after TEMPLATE_VER.

sealed setting: ARCHIVE_KEY3=8d0

TURN-208: Gatevale turnstile counters at the Merrow Field pilot double-count when a rotation reverses mid-cycle. Attendance totals drift roughly 2% high per event. The debounce window fix is implemented, reviewed by Ilsa, and soak-tested across two simulated match days without drift. Ready for your cut; the candidate build is identified below.

trace token, tagag-tafog: htk6_5ed18c

Heads up for the Velmora 3.2 cut: the new GPU memory profiler (project Gristmill) eats about 400MB per tracked device, so the staging pool needs two extra nodes before we flip it on fleet-wide. Sampling intervals are the main lever if we run hot. The constants we settled on after last week's load test are below.

tuning table, yajog-yahof:
BUDGETS = {
    "lamvan": 303,
    "wenox": 460,
    "fenvan": 525,
}

Management Meeting Minutes — Loyalty Overhaul

Attendees: sales leads, ops, marketing. Dovan presented the redesign of the Orbit Rewards programme. Agreed: tier thresholds will be simplified from five to three, and point expiry extended to 18 months. Kessler flagged margin impact in the Harwick region; finance to model by Friday. Rollout communications drafted by end of month. Migration of legacy accounts remains the open risk. The board's direction on this is summarised in the note below.

internal memo for hahaf-kahof: Only 39 of the 428 pilot accounts renewed Sorion, so a churn review is set for April 12. Praokix Freight is in early talks to buy Queniusox Group for about $145.8 million.